Vietnam hastens to import 6 tonnes of gold

Section: Daily Dispatches

From Thanh Nien newspaper
Ho Chi Minh City, Vietnam
Thursday, November 19, 2009

http://dailynews.vn/frame/index.php?url=aHR0cDovL3d3dy50aGFuaG5pZW5uZXdz...

Vietnam will import 6 tonnes of gold this month, state broadcaster VTV said on Thursday, after the central bank last week lifted a ban on imports to stabilize an overheating market.
